Mission

Working to end poverty in the u.s. So children, families, and individuals can access the material basic needs that all people require to thrive.

Programs

3 programs

Alliance for period supplies - an ndbn program launched in 2018 - has distributed more than 45 million period products (pads and liners) donated by founding sponsor u by kotex, thinx, and poise, among others to more than 140 allied members in the u.s. Members also receive expert technical assistance as described above. Alliance for period supplies hosts the national summit on period poverty leadsership as part of the u.s. Conference on poverty and basic needs, which fosters collaboration and support among people and organizations working to address period poverty, period stigma, and menstrual equity in the united states.

Expenses: $1.9MGrants: $1.7M

Awareness - ndbn brings national attention to the issues of diaper need and period poverty by focuing on the impact that material hardship has on individuals, children and families living in the u.s. Awareness is expanded through the educational outreach to the general public as well as local and national leaders via media and proprietary initiatives. As the recognized center of authority on diaper need in america, ndbn collects, analyzes, and reports relevant data to advance policy/advocacy efforts related to diaper need, child poverty, and the physical, mental and economic well-being of children and families.
